WebScaffolding and SRL. Scaffolding is a dynamic interaction between the learner and an other. The other provides support that is carefully calibrated to the goal of the task and the learner’s current level of mastery relative to that goal. Through scaffolding, learners can achieve something that would not be possible by themselves. ... WebOct 13, 2024 · The function of scaffolding proteins is to bring together two or more proteins in a relatively stable configuration, hence their name. Numerous scaffolding proteins are found in nature, many having multiple protein–protein interaction modules. Over the past decade, examples of scaffolding complexes long thought to be stable have instead …
